The Organising Committee of the Diplomatic Regatta consists of members of the Diplomatic Corps, in other words, people who gave the Regatta its name, then representatives of general sponsors, namely people who guarantee the necessary financial sources for the Regatta, and distinguished representatives of the Slovenian political and business communities, namely those who can contribute to the popularisation of this event and the promotion of sailing in Slovenia.
